Abstract
The utility model is a kind of target seeker cabin member mounting connection structure, including ceramic radome fairing (1), metal shell (2), member (5), end face attachment screw (8), the ceramics radome fairing (1) is mounted on metal shell (2) outside, positive stop lug boss is equipped on the inside of metal shell (2) rear end face, member (5) is put into metal shell (2) from metal shell (2) rear end face, the tail portion of member (5) is contacted with positive stop lug boss, and is fixed by attachment screw (8).The utility model is easy to operate, facilitates operation, can Fast Installation member to designated position, realize that member is reliably installed, eliminate member cantilever beam force structure.

Background technique
Target seeker cabin is mounted on projectile nose, target seeker cabin mainly install sensor and servo rotating mechanism etc. it is accurate at
Part.In guided missile supersonic flight, target seeker cabin will bear the operating conditions such as high temperature, high pressure, shock and vibration, overload.In order to drop
Low pneumatic heat transfer enters inside cabin on member, reduces from head entering signal dissipation of energy, target seeker cabin uses ceramics
Material radome fairing.
At work, target seeker cabin requires ceramic radome fairing to connect with metal shell reliably, internal member connection structure and
Metal shell connection is reliable.When ceramic radome fairing and when metal shell is cementing or soldering connection, for primary assembly forming, do not have
Repeat dismounting function.Based on the connection type, it is unable to prepared screw-bolt hole on ceramic radome fairing, makes member and metal shell in front end
Connection, internal member can only be connect in member rear end face with metal shell by bolt, and the member of the connection type is in stress shape
At cantilever beam force structure in formula.When member bears vibration, impact, overloading load, in load transmission to metal shell end face.

Specific embodiment:
The invention will be described in further detail with reference to the accompanying drawing.
The utility model is referring to Fig. 1-Fig. 2, and a kind of target seeker cabin member mounting connection structure is by ceramic radome fairing 1, metal
Shell 2, insulating rubber 3, sponge rubber plate 4, member 5, end face attachment screw 8 form.
Metal shell 2 is in the front end that member 5 is installed, and the front end of member 5 is for pyramidal structure, and processing dimension can not mention
Required precision is guaranteed by the insulating rubber 3 and sponge rubber plate 4 of compression.
There are sponge rubber 4 and insulating rubber 3 to design between member 5 and metal shell 2, rubber thickness is according to proportion of deformation
It being designed with heat insulation, sponge rubber 4 and insulating rubber 3 are pre-installed on member one end, by other end Bolt Tightening Force,
Double-layer rubber is compressed, is deformed in linear deformation stage.
Insulating rubber 3 and 4 thickness of sponge rubber plate are designed in decrement ratio.
Insulating rubber 3 and sponge rubber plate 4 to different-thickness carry out compression test, measuring force and deformation displacement number respectively
According to.To insulating rubber 3 relatively and under 4 power load same state of sponge rubber plate, the deflection of insulating rubber 3 is sponge rubber plate
1/5 or so of 4, and for 2mm sponge rubber in deflection within the scope of 0mm-0.6mm, deflection and compressing force are in ratio line
Property.For the sponge rubber 4 of 3mm or more thickness within the scope of the deflection of 1/2 thickness, deflection is proportional to compressing force linear.
On insulating rubber 3 and 4 thickness of sponge rubber plate installation member 5, it is flat to be less than metal shell 2 for radial overall size after installation
Straight section size.
The utility model is easy to operate, facilitates operation, can Fast Installation member to designated position.When installation, by member 5 from
One laterally inner side of the opening of metal shell 2 pushes, and is pushed to insulating rubber 3 and is in contact with metal shell 2.
Adjustment member 5 posture so that its end face attachment screw position is matched with 2 screw hole location of metal shell, firmly to
Inside pushes member 5, after member 5 is installed in place, installs end face attachment screw 8.
When end face attachment screw 8 is installed, in any symmetrical two screw precessions metal shell, 2 screw hole, then remaining is twisted
Screw finally screws screw.
